Summary, etc. "Charles Sumner: His Complete Works, Volume 09" by Charles Sumner is a historical account written in the late 19th century. This volume focuses on a selection of speeches and writings by Sumner, a prominent abolitionist and U.S. Senator, addressing themes of civil rights, the powers of Congress during the Civil War, and the complexities of legality surrounding slavery and rebellion. The content showcases Sumner's efforts to intertwine legal, moral, and political arguments in his quest for justice and equality. The opening of this volume introduces a pivotal speech delivered by Sumner on May 19, 1862, which advocates for the confiscation of property owned by rebels and the emancipation of slaves held by those in rebellion against the United States. Sumner employs historical and legal references to assert that the ongoing Civil War is both rebellion and war, thus justifying Congress’s powers to act against traitors, both as criminals and enemies. He emphasizes the importance of remaining aligned with constitutional principles while arguing for decisive action to secure the nation’s unity and freedom for enslaved individuals. His compelling rhetoric and the historical context set the stage for a broader discussion on civil rights and governmental authority during a time of national crisis.
